锌盐催化尿素和甲醇合成碳酸二甲酯

摘    要:以尿素和甲醇为原料,各种锌盐为催化剂,在反应釜中合成了碳酸二甲酯(DMC).实验结果表明,在相同的实验条件下,ZnCl2具有最佳的催化性能.进一步研究表明,该路线为两步反应,首先由尿素和甲醇反应生成中间物氨基甲酸甲酯(MC),第二步MC继续和甲醇反应生成DMC,其中第二步反应为速控步骤.并且以该催化剂为模板催化剂,考察了反应条件如:反应温度、反应时间和催化剂用量对DMC收率的影响.结果表明,当反应温度为180℃,反应时间为8h,催化剂用量为1.0g时,DMC收率可以达到28.9%.

关 键 词:尿素  甲醇  碳酸二甲酯  氯化锌

Synthesis of Dimethyl Carbonate from Urea and Methanol over Zinc Salts

Abstract:In the batch reactor, several zinc salts were used as the catalysts for the synthesis of dimethyl carbonate (DMC) from urea and methanol. Under the same conditions, ZnC12 presented the best catalytic performance. In further study, it was re- vealed that this reaction could be divided into two steps. The intermediate methyl carbamate (MC) was first formed, and fur- ther converted to DMC by reaction of MC with methanol. And the second step was the key and rate - control step for this ap- proach. In addition, using ZnC12 as the model catalyst, the effects of reaction conditions on its catalytic performance were ex- plored in details. The catalytic evaluation results indicated that under optimal reaction conditions: reaction temperature 180 ℃, reaction time 8 h, catalyst amount 1.0 g, the DEC yield was about 28.9%.
Keywords:urea  methanol  dimethyl carbonate  ZnCl2
